LG08 OTU is a 2008 Jaguar Xk in Green with a 4,196c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 20 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 80%.
Across all 2008 Jaguar Xk models, the average MOT pass rate is 82.7% with a typical mileage of 50,092 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Jaguar Xk f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 1,872 recorded failures. If you're considering buying LG08 OTU,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Jaguar Xk typically stays on UK roads for around 20 years. At 18 years old, this Jaguar Xk is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
